1960 Aston Martin DB2 vs. 1977 Peugeot 504

To start off, 1977 Peugeot 504 is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1960 Aston Martin DB2.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1960 Aston Martin DB2 would be higher. At 2,922 cc (6 cylinders), 1960 Aston Martin DB2 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1960 Aston Martin DB2 (118 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 46 more horse power than 1977 Peugeot 504. (72 HP @ 4500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1960 Aston Martin DB2 should accelerate faster than 1977 Peugeot 504.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1977 Peugeot 504 weights approximately 85 kg more than 1960 Aston Martin DB2.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1960 Aston Martin DB2 (241 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 106 more torque (in Nm) than 1977 Peugeot 504. (135 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 1960 Aston Martin DB2 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1977 Peugeot 504.

Compare all specifications:

1960 Aston Martin DB2 1977 Peugeot 504
Make Aston Martin Peugeot
Model DB2 504
Year Released 1960 1977
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2922 cc 2304 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 118 HP 72 HP
Engine RPM 5000 RPM 4500 RPM
Torque 241 Nm 135 Nm
Torque RPM 3000 RPM 2000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Diesel
Drive Type Rear Rear
Number of Seats 4 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Weight 1175 kg 1260 kg
Vehicle Length 4310 mm 4500 mm
Vehicle Width 1660 mm 1700 mm
Vehicle Height 1370 mm 1470 mm
Wheelbase Size 2520 mm 2750 mm
